What Is Copy Trading and How Does It Work?

Copy trading is a form of social trading where you link your account to a professional trader. Every time the expert opens or closes a trade, the same action is mirrored in your account. This is ideal for beginners in Armenia who want to learn from seasoned traders while potentially earning profits. Most brokers provide a copy trading platform where you can browse trader profiles, view their performance metrics, and allocate funds accordingly.

Key Features to Look For

When selecting a copy trading service in Armenia, consider: risk management tools (stop-loss, take-profit), transparent performance history, and the ability to set maximum drawdown limits. Common Mistakes Armenia Traders Make

  • Mistake: Copying too many traders at once
    Spreading your capital across too many traders can dilute returns and increase complexity. Focus on 2-3 top performers instead.
  • Mistake: Ignoring risk metrics
    Many Armenia traders only look at profit percentage. Always check drawdown, risk score, and trading frequency to avoid high-risk strategies.
  • Mistake: Not setting a stop-loss
    Failing to set a maximum loss limit can lead to significant losses. Use the broker’s risk management tools to protect your capital.

Practical Tips for Armenia Traders

  • Start Small: Begin with a small amount (e.g., $50) to test the copy trading service and the trader’s performance before committing more capital.
  • Diversify Your Portfolio: Copy multiple traders with different strategies to spread risk. Avoid putting all funds into a single trader.
  • Monitor Regularly: Check your copied traders’ performance weekly. If a trader’s drawdown exceeds your comfort level, stop copying them.
  • Use Stop-Loss: Set a maximum loss limit on your copy trading account to protect your capital from sudden market swings.
  • Check Fees: Some brokers charge a performance fee or spread markup. Compare these costs before selecting a trader.
